The cost of living difference between San Luis, CO and Silver Plume, CO is dramatic. San Luis is 35.5% cheaper than Silver Plume, a gap that translates to thousands of dollars per year in household expenses. San Luis has a cost index of 68 while Silver Plume sits at 105, making this one of the more striking comparisons on our site. Relocating between these cities would require a serious reassessment of budget and lifestyle expectations.

On the housing front, median rent in San Luis is $700/month compared to $966/month in Silver Plume — a 28% difference. Home values follow the same pattern: San Luis is more affordable at $137,500 median vs $477,300.

Median household income in San Luis is $30,481 compared to $51,458 in Silver Plume (-40.8%). While Silver Plume is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income. Looking at affordability, residents of San Luis spend roughly 27.6% of their income on rent, more than the 22.5% in Silver Plume.
